In this video, Moussa Kadri repeatedly slashes a knife at a man for burning a Koran. Today, he has been spared jail time. In the sentencing remarks, the Judge said: "I note however that you are now 59 years old and someone of hitherto exemplary character… You are a loved husband and father. A hard worker and someone who, those who have written on your behalf cannot praise highly enough. You are relied upon as a carer and much respected in your work with charity.” The man he slashes a knife at is Hamit Coskun, who was burning a Koran in protest. For this, Hamit was originally charged by the CPS with intent to cause "harassment, alarm or distress" against "the religious institution of Islam". This charge was dropped, and changed to a Public Order Offence: disorderly behaviour within the hearing or sight of a person likely to be caused harassment, alarm or distress. Part of the prosecution’s evidence that Hamit had caused someone harassment, alarm or distress was that Moussa Kadri attacked him with a knife. Hamit was convicted and ordered to pay a fine of £240. He is also now living in hiding due to credible threats to his life. Moussa Kadri, the man who tries to stab him in this video, is walking free.

The Imam suggests that Sharia law is nothing to be concerned about. Interestingly, Imam Sabah Ahmedi is an Ahmadiyya Muslim. Ahmadiyya Muslims can face extreme persecution from other Muslims who deem them blasphemers due to their belief in the separation of Mosque and state. In 2016, Sunni Muslim Tanveer Ahmed from Bradford stabbed Ahmadiyya Muslim Asad Shah outside his store in Shawlands, Glasgow. Ahmed travelled all the way from Bradford to Glasgow to murder him for blasphemy. In Pakistan, Ahmadiyya Muslims face state sanctioned persecution.
